POSITION SUMMARY:
Participates in all aspects of care of neuro-surgery patients under the direction of collaborating neurosurgery and attending physicians. Responsible for assessing, planning, implementing and evaluating patient care provided to assigned patient population. This includes preoperative evaluation and postoperative care of neurosurgical patients with implementation of therapies and processes to meet all patient needs. Also includes off service patient population with need for consultation with neurosurgical specialists.
FUNCTIONAL RESPONSIBILITIES AND DUTIES:
Patient work-up including history and physical examination with ordering of appropriate laboratory tests, x-ray studies, and other diagnostic studies as indicated.
Completion of daily hospital work rounds for on and off service patients.
Completion of history and physicals, consultations, progress notes, and discharge summaries as directed by service needs.
Performing diagnostic or therapeutic procedures as needed (within the scope of practice of the supervising physician).
Performing First Aid/Basic Life Support resuscitation with participation in annual review.
Maintenance of ACLS Provider status.
Evaluation and coordination of a plan of care in conjunction with attending physicians and other team members.
Proficient use of EMR.
Required skills and abilities
Advanced patient management skills necessary to care for critically ill patients in the emergency department, intensive care, or general surgical floor setting.
Strong interpersonal and communication skills for effective interaction with patients, families, consulting physicians and hospital staff.
Ability to interact with grieving family members in a compassionate manner.
Ability to walk and stand continuously and to lift and position patients.
Required education, experience and licensure
Graduation from accredited Physician Assistant program or Nurse Practitioner program Certification by the National Commission on Certification of Physician Assistants (PAs only) State of Michigan
Physician’s Assistant or Nurse Practitioner License
DEA Controlled Substance Registration Certificate, United States Dept. of Justice
Advanced Cardiovascular Life Support Provider Certification
Advanced Trauma Life Support Provider Certification
